Desktop Window Manager Session Manager (UxSms) Service on Windows Server 2008
What is the "Desktop Window Manager Session Manager (UxSms)" system service on Windows Server 2008? Can I disable "Desktop Window Manager Session Manager"?
✍: FYIcenter.com
"Desktop Window Manager Session Manager (UxSms)" is a Windows Server 2008 service that
provides Desktop Window Manager startup and maintenance services.
Detailed information on "Desktop Window Manager Session Manager" service:
Service name: UxSms Display name: Desktop Window Manager Session Manager Execution command: C:\Windows\System32\svchost.exe -k LocalSystemNetworkRestricted
"Desktop Window Manager Session Manager" service is provided by the svchost.exe program, see "svchost.exe Executable Program on Windows Server 2008" for details.
Disabling "Desktop Window Manager Session Manager" service may cause issues when running Windows Server 2008 system.
